How to take a photo or video with your Chromebook
In the corner of your screen, select the Launcher .
Open Camera . Then, on the right side, choose an option:
Select Photo Take photo .
Select Video Start recording .
Select Square Take photo .
You can also change how your photos or videos are captured:
Change your settings: Select Settings . Change the size of the grid, the length of the timer, or the camera resolution.
Flip your photo from left to right: Select Mirror .
Use gridlines to straighten photos: Select Grid .
Switch between cameras: At the left, select Switch camera . Tip: You can only switch cameras if you plug in an external camera or your Chromebook has 2 built-in cameras.
Take photos with a timer: Select Timer .
Scan documents with Google Drive
Scan a document
Open the Google Drive app .
In the bottom right, tap Add .
Tap Scan .
Take a photo of the document you'd like to scan.
Adjust scan area: Tap Crop .
Take photo again: Tap Re-scan current page .
Scan another page: Tap Add .
To save the finished document, tap Done .
Add a scanning shortcut to your Home screen
To set up a shortcut to scan documents:
Open your Android phone or tablet’s widgets.
Find the "Drive scan" widget.
Touch and hold the widget.
Drag it onto your Home screen. You may be asked to select an account.
Choose the folder you’ll save documents inside. If you want to create a folder, tap New Folder .
Tap Select. You’ll see the folder name in the widget.
